Description | South Yorkshire County Council Election. Discussion with Tom Steele, Peter Wigley (Sheffield Publicity Officer), Patrick Seyd (Sheffield University) and Nicholas Comfort (Morning Telegraph). 1) Need to bombard people with information to encourage them to vote, 2) People only turn out to vote if policies affect their pocket. Publicity doesn't matter. 3) Aspects of manifestos which will affect results. 4) New County Council could encourage more people into politics and so raise standards. 5) Expected turn out abour 30%. |
